The beginners guide to crowdfunding a farm

Funding a farm isn’t easy. Equipment, personnel, and promotional material all rapidly eat up precious resources. If you’re a new farmer, you’re probably searching for ways to reach the startup capital you need or to get those necessary cash infusions to boost your ability to scale up.

One of the most innovative ways to start a farm today is crowdfunding. Crowdfunding a farm boils down to convincing your friends, family, and community to invest in your dream farm. The funding method offers a kickstart to your marketing strategy and a funding option with no repayment, all in one tantalizing package.

But the reality is that crowdfunding is a challenging way to raise money, especially for those unfamiliar with issues unique to crowdfunding. It takes a lot of research, planning, and several weeks of good hard hustle. That’s why Upstart University put together a helpful guide to crowdfunding for those considering raising money for their farming project through this unique approach.
